As Japan’s aging senior population expands and the nations birth rate falls, a major push is under way to produce a cost effective means of caring for geriatric patients. Panasonic has stepped up to the plate with the development of a hair washing robot that could be used at hospitals or nursing homes. They hope [...]

Shinya Kimura is a Japanese born custom bike maker.  As founder of Zero Engineering Kimura has brought a no frills minimalistic and vintage artistry to motorcycle design. The visual and functional aspects of his work have become know as the Zero-style bike.  His bikes share key design features such as “a rigid gooseneck, a pre-1984 [...]
